IRG8P40N120KDPBF technical specifications, attributes, and parameters.
| Attributes | Value | |
|---|---|---|
| Category | Transistors/Thyristors/IGBT Transistors / Modules | |
| Manufacturer | Infineon Technologies | |
| Package | TO-247AC | |
| Operating Temperature | -40℃~+150℃@(Tj) | |
| Reverse Recovery Time(trr) | 80ns | |
| Td(off) | 245ns | |
| Gate Charge(Qg) | 240nC | |
| Switching Energy(Eoff) | 1.8mJ | |
| Current - Collector(Ic) | 60A | |
| Pd - Power Dissipation | 305W | |
| Turn-On Energy (Eon) | 1.6mJ | |
| Td(on) | 40ns | |
| Collector-Emitter Breakdown Voltage (Vces) | 1.2kV |
